IN RE: S.R.B., BY her next friend, and Christine Renee WOJTASIK, Respondent, v. Shane Michael BACKES, Appellant.
ORDER
Shane Backes appeals from a trial court judgment addressing requests to modify child custody, parenting time, and child support. Backes argues that the trial court's determinations regarding child custody and parenting time do not comply with relevant law in light of the evidence presented. Backes also argues that the trial court's modification of child support was improperly entered and failed to consider missing financial records. Finding no error, we affirm. Rule 84.16(b).
Per Curiam:
